Bagikan melalui


Fungsi SetAbortProc (wingdi.h)

Fungsi SetAbortProc mengatur fungsi pembatalan yang ditentukan aplikasi yang memungkinkan pekerjaan cetak dibatalkan selama penampungan.

Sintaks

int SetAbortProc(
  [in] HDC       hdc,
  [in] ABORTPROC proc
);

Parameter

[in] hdc

Tangani ke konteks perangkat untuk pekerjaan cetak.

[in] proc

Penunjuk ke fungsi abort yang ditentukan aplikasi. Untuk informasi selengkapnya tentang fungsi panggilan balik, lihat fungsi panggilan balik AbortProc .

Nilai kembali

Jika fungsi berhasil, nilai yang dikembalikan lebih besar dari nol.

Jika fungsi gagal, nilai yang dikembalikan adalah SP_ERROR.

Keterangan

Catatan Ini adalah fungsi pemblokiran atau sinkron dan mungkin tidak segera dikembalikan. Seberapa cepat fungsi ini kembali tergantung pada faktor run-time seperti status jaringan, konfigurasi server cetak, dan implementasi driver printer—faktor yang sulit diprediksi saat menulis aplikasi. Memanggil fungsi ini dari utas yang mengelola interaksi dengan antarmuka pengguna dapat membuat aplikasi tampak tidak responsif.
 

Contoh

Misalnya, lihat Cara Mengumpulkan Informasi Pekerjaan Cetak dari Pengguna.

Persyaratan

Persyaratan Nilai
Klien minimum yang didukung Windows 2000 Professional [hanya aplikasi desktop]
Server minimum yang didukung Windows 2000 Server [hanya aplikasi desktop]
Target Platform Windows
Header wingdi.h (sertakan Windows.h)
Pustaka Gdi32.lib
DLL Gdi32.dll

Lihat juga

AbortDoc

AbortProc

Cetak Fungsi API Spooler

Pencetakan